Overview
At Money Forward Inc., we are dedicated to transforming financial services using advanced technology. With over 50 services for individuals and businesses, including popular products like "Money Forward ME" and "Money Forward Cloud", we help make managing money easier. We use cutting-edge "account aggregation" technology to gather user data, turning it into useful insights for our customers.
Within the Money Forward Business Company (MFBC), "Money Forward Cloud" is a component-based cloud ERP composed of multiple service groups. While these groups provide flexibility for users to choose combinations based on their needs, developing them in isolation can lead to data silos, inconsistent user experiences, and reduced development efficiency. To solve this, our Business Platform Development (BPD) division builds the common foundations that unify these services and ensures their stable use across the company.
Our division is responsible for developing and managing shared microservices and backend systems that power workflows and platform functionality across "Money Forward Cloud". We work to standardize services, improve collaboration across products, and enhance performance and scalability. By organizing complex system logic, addressing technical debt, and documenting our knowledge, we aim to create a reliable, maintainable, and future-ready platform that delivers consistent value for both developers and end-users.
